Duo Fleur Strijbos & Babette Craens

When soprano Fleur Strijbos and pianist Babette Craens share the stage, something special unfolds. Since 2022, they have formed a Liedduo known for their dynamic interpretations, refined musicianship, and undeniable chemistry on stage. With music and poetry as their allies, they breathe new life into the classical Lied repertoire in a contemporary and captivating way.


The two first met at the Royal Conservatory of Antwerp, where they were inspired by masters like Lucienne Van Deyck, Jozef De Beenhouwer, and Aäron Wajnberg .What began as a shared passion for the Lied has since evolved into a deep artistic connection, laying the foundation for their distinctive sound.


With performances both in Belgium and abroad, Fleur and Babette are quickly building their reputation. They participated in the ‘Udo Reinemann Masterclasses Lied Duo 2022-2023’, were semifinalists in ‘Supernova 2024’, and received a standing ovation for their debut concert at Beaujean-Live’s ‘Young Masters’ in 2023. Since 2024, they have proudly been members of the ‘Vrienden van het Lied’.

Fleur Strijbos (voice) & Emma Wills (guitar)

Duo Leora

Soprano Fleur Strijbos and guitarist Emma Wills formed their dynamic duo, Duo Leora, after their successful collaboration at the Walden Festival of Klara in 2024. Their paths first crossed at the Royal Conservatoire of Antwerp, but they truly connected when both of them were invited by the national classical music radio station Klara for the series 'De Twintigers,' Emma in 2022, followed by Fleur in 2024.


Their "Echoes of Spain" program captivated a full audience at the Citizens’ Garden in the heart of Brussels, inspiring them to continue their musical journey together. The name "Leora," meaning "light" in Hebrew and Greek, reflects their shared vision of illuminating classical music with fresh, expressive interpretations.

Yentl & Fleur

"Yentl & Fleur" is a unique duo that combines the jazz vocals of Yentl Verborgt with the classical voice of Fleur Strijbos. Since 2016, these two very different voices have come together in a shared pop style to create original songs and fresh takes on existing ones. What makes them special? Their voices might be worlds apart in background, but when they sing together, it’s pure magic.


In 2022, Yentl & Fleur wrapped up their project ‘In the Clouds’, where they teamed up with pianist Lars Van de Voorde. Inspired by the ever-changing sky, they turned their love for clouds into beautiful music. But they’re not stopping there. Be Moved 

"Be Moved" began in 2019 as a graduation project and has since grown into a meaningful collaboration between two close friends. Classical sopranos Fleur Strijbos and Marjolein Appermont, both graduates of the Royal Conservatory of Antwerp, bring together a diverse group of musicians to create performances that deeply connect with audiences.


Their debut project, "Be Moved - Music from Life", became a touching initiative during the pandemic. It involved personal stories from people about how certain pieces of music had a special impact on their lives. These stories were brought to life in performances by Strijbos and Appermont, along with tenor Lars Corijn and pianist Jonathan Fremout.


Strijbos and Appermont are currently working on their newest project, "100 jaar Maria Callas", with pianist Mike Docters.They’re excited about what’s next and have many more creative projects in the works.
